FTC Issues Rule Against Debt Relief Companies

Collections & Credit Risk | Thursday, July 29, 2010

For-profit companies that sell debt relief services by telephone, as of Oct. 27, will not be able to charge a fee before they settle or reduce a customer’s credit card or other unsecured debt.
